Tiger Woods returns to the series for another round of golf in this installment. The most notable addition to this version is EA’s Game Face, which allows you to change the physical look of the players. You have the fundamentals, such as hair, skin, facial hair, and other general appearances. Still, Game Face allows you to modify everything else, including tooth shape, logos, tattoos, headbands, caps, and more. Individual body mass, muscle tone, midsection, arms, and legs can all be altered. You can also select unique swing animations, post-putt and celebration animations, and “pissed off” animations for when you make a triple bogey.

World Tour is a new option that puts you through a standard 52-week PGA tour to win money, sponsorships, and better gear. You can play for as many as twenty seasons. Another new game mode is Battle Golf, in which you can win an opponent’s clubs by defeating them. Other normal game modes are present, such as Skill Challenge, Speed Golf, and Skins Match and Practice.

The game’s ability to scan your console’s internal clock and give you game modes is a novel feature. If it’s near the end of October and your clock is set correctly, you might be invited to a Halloween event where you can win event-specific prizes.

You can play as (or against) all the great PGA players, including Vijay Singh and Justin Leonard. Newcomers to the sport, such as John Daly, have also been added.

Most of the 2003 courses have survived, along with seven new actual and fantastical techniques. Bethpage Black, an exceedingly challenging course in Washington, is one of the new courses.

Tiger Woods PGA Tour 2004, like all other 2004 EA Sports console games, has the EA Sports Bio, which tracks your achievements and games across all EA Sports products. The more EA Sports games you play and the longer you play them, the higher your EA Gamer Level and the more incentives you unlock, such as a new driver in Tiger Woods or historic teams in NHL 2004. This feature is not available on the PC version.

Customers who purchase the PlayStation 2 version can play online using EA’s matchmaking service. The Xbox and GameCube versions cannot be used to play online.

If you purchase the GameCube version, you can connect the GameBoy Advance to the GameCube to gain access to special awards not available through standard play.
